What does 'OP' mean
There are two definitions for and ways to use the slang term "OP."
First is "OP" means "original poster." This usage comes from chat forums. It refers to the initial person who made a post or started a thread, such as on Reddit. Now, "OP" is broadly used to identify whoever made the original post that someone replying to, such as on Instagram, TikTok, Twitter or any other social media platform. "OP" can also be short for "original post."
Second is "OP" stands for "overpowered." In this case, "OP" describes a skill, character or weapon in a game is incredibly strong. This usage was popularized in online gaming communities.
How to use 'OP'
Here are some examples of how to use "OP":
- "Did you see the news about Taylor Swift's latest surprise songs on TikTok?" "No, could you send me the OP?"
- "The OP said the movie was coming out in July."
- "Their skills in 'Call of Duty' are so OP it's not even fun to play with them anymore."
